I applied through a recruiter. I interviewed at Alorica (San Nicolas, Ilocos Norte)
Interview
I had my initial interview online, and afterward, I was given the option to do the final interview either online or in person. I recommend choosing the in-person option if possible, as it may help ensure a smoother experience—both for the interview itself and any accompanying assessments.
While I understand that experiences may vary, I want to share that my final interview was quite challenging. The interviewer’s approach came across as unprofessional—he made discouraging remarks about my abilities, openly expressed disbelief in my responses, and even spoke inappropriately about previous applicants. I hope this isn’t typical, but I believe it’s worth being aware of.

The interview process is smooth and easy. There is an initial interview and an exam that you have to pass first before the final interview. It is just a one day process and it is very efficient.
